Disasters lead to search for ‘Safest City, USA’


“Maybe Montana or Idaho for any low tornado threat, no possibility of a hurricane, low although not zero quake threat,” proffers storm expert Greg Forbes from the Weather Funnel.

Some have attempted to pre-plan the danger. The Brand New You are able to Occasions last April demonstrated a lot of the South engrossed in red-colored dots showing “greater risk,” as the West Coast was dotted an appropriate eco-friendly. (A more compact, secondary map did note the West’s earthquake risk.)

Others have develop lists. After Hurricane Katrina, Forbes magazine created one showing that Honolulu, Hawaii, was the most secure U.S. city depending on past records.

However, many folks going for a lengthy take on disasters, i.e. insurance experts and government researchers, possess a different perspective: Everywhere includes a risk.

“Safe is really a relative term,” states Julie Rochman, leader from the Insurance Institute for Business & Home Safety. “Give me an idea safe from?”

Montana, Idaho? They are seeing flooding now and have ample knowledge about wildfires.

Free Airline Coast? Aside from the apparent earthquakes, there’s danger of tsunamis, landslides and wildfires.

Honolulu? The Elements Funnel lately referred to it as the town “most past due” for any major hurricane.

In addition, Rochman asks, would you like your problems to become periodic, e.g. severe weather and tornadoes, or surprises, e.g. earthquakes and tsunamis.

When it involves Nature, “we’re an extremely diverse country,” she adds. “We’re the tornado capital from the planet, and Clearwater, Florida, may be the lightning capital. We now have two shorelines along with a southern and northern latitude.”

A lot of natural disaster data for that nation is put together through the U.S. Geological Survey, yet even that agency does not wish to put an excessive amount of belief within the number and placement of problems.

“Unless of course you’re in a fallout shelter in the center of some strange desolate place, I am unsure use a data set to express this is when you need to live,” states USGS spokesperson Mark Newell.

“Everywhere features its own natural risks,” he adds. “Should you put a location on the map I will tell you 2 to 3 effects of just living there.”

What exactly to complete? Change and mitigate.

Newell has resided in California (quakes), Texas (drought) and Washington D.C. (blizzard) and today resides in Missouri (tornadoes). “You realize the atmosphere that you are in and adjust to it,” he states.

“I do not see Missouri as tornado alley,” he adds. “You just need to realize that each area will bring a number of climate and natural disaster hazards.”

The insurance coverage industry focus is on planning.

“It is more essential to mitigate” rather than uproot yourself, states Terese Rosenthal, the U.S. speaker for MunichRE, among the biggest firms that reinsure the insurance companies.

“This is exactly why we push building codes,” adds Rochman.

“Nobody size fits all,” she appreciates, and “among the challenges we now have is you can only speak with people about a lot of stuff that are frightening or they get frozen in position.Inch

Rochman feels that as lengthy as insurance costs aren’t subsidized to safeguard people in dangerous areas, they are able to send a weighted risk message to citizens. “When they are correctly set,” she states, “they make the perfect indication that you’re doing, or otherwise doing, something dangerous.”

Experts: Seas heading for mass extinctions


Mass extinctions of species within the world’s oceans are inevitable if current trends of overfishing, habitat loss, climatic change and pollution continue, a panel of famous marine researchers cautioned Tuesday.

The mixture of problems indicates there is a brewing worldwide die-from species that will rival past mass extinctions, the 27 researchers stated inside a preliminary report given to the Un.

Disappearing species – from ocean turtles to barrier – would upend the ocean’s ecosystem. Seafood would be the primary supply of protein for any fifth from the world’s population and also the seas cycle oxygen and help absorb co2, the primary green house gas from human activities.

“Things appear to become failing on a number of different levels,” stated Carl Lundin, director of global marine programs in the Worldwide Union for Conservation of Character, which assisted produce the report using the Worldwide Programme about the Condition from the Sea.

A few of the changes affecting the earth’s seas – that have been cautioned about individually previously – are happening faster compared to worst situation situations which were predicted only a couple of years back, the report stated.

“It had been a far more dire report than anybody thought because we glance at our very own little issues,” Lundin stated. “Whenever you place them altogether, it is a pretty bleak situation.”

Climate and barrier

Barrier deaths alone would be described as a mass extinction, based on study chief author Alex Rogers from the College of Oxford. Just one bleaching event in 1998 wiped out one-sixth from the world’s tropical barrier reefs.

Lundin pointed to deaths of just one,000-year-old barrier within the Indian Sea and known as it “really unparalleled.”

“Not just shall we be already going through severe declines in several species to the stage of business extinction in some instances, as well as an unequalled rate of regional extinctions of habitat types (e.g. mangroves and seagrass meadows), but we have now face losing marine species and entire marine environments, for example barrier reefs, inside a single generation,” professionals stated.

The main causes for extinctions right now are overfishing and habitat loss, but climatic change is “progressively contributing to this,” the report stated.

Co2 in the burning of non-renewable fuels eventually ends up sinking within the oceans, which in turn be acidic, devastating sensitive barrier reefs. Warmer sea temps are also shifting species using their normal habitats, Rogers stated. Non-native species getting into new areas may cause havoc to individuals environments.

Jelle Bijma, from the Alfred Wegener Institute, stated the seas faced a “deadly trio” of risks of greater temps, acidification and insufficient oxygen which had featured in a number of past mass extinctions.

Runoff from manure into rivers and seas has reduced oxygen in individuals areas, creating a large number of “dead zones” world wide. The U.S. Geological Survey earlier this year stated it needs the dead zone in the Mississippi River to create an archive when it develops later this summer time because of flooding runoff.

“From the geological perspective, mass extinctions happen overnight, but on human timescales we might not understand that we’re in the center of this kind of event,” Bijma authored.

Chemicals and plastics from daily existence are also leading to trouble for ocean animals, the report stated. Overall, the earth’s oceans just cannot recover from problems – for example oil spills – like they accustomed to due to all of the adding to factors, researchers stated.

Confounding probably the most dire forecasts, the Gulf has returned back from last year’s major oil spill, but it’s still coping with the growing “dead zone” and above average ocean temps.

Similar ‘stressors’ in past extinctions

Explaining the multiple occasions affecting the earth’s oceans as high intensity “triggers,” professionals stated similar adding to brought towards the previous five mass extinction occasions previously 600 million years – most lately once the dinosaurs disappeared sixty five million years back, apparently after an asteroid struck.

Data: The go up and down of Earth’s species (in this article)

The conclusions follow an worldwide meeting this spring in England to go over the fate from the world’s oceans. A complete report is going to be released later this season, the panel stated.

Lundin stated that “a few of these situations are reversible as we change our behavior.”

Overfishing may be the simplest for government authorities to deal with, professionals stated.

“Unlike global warming, it may be directly, immediately and effectively handled by policy change,” stated William Cheung from the College of East Anglia. “Overfishing has become believed to take into account over 60 % from the known local and global extinction of marine fishes.”

Among good examples of overfishing would be the Chinese bahaba. Its go swimming bladder is preferred in Asia like a medicinal product, and also the cost per kilo (2.2 pounds) has risen from the couple of dollars within the nineteen thirties to $20,000-$70,000 today.

Listed as significantly endangered, the bahaba is among a lot more than 500 marine species threatened by overfishing, Cheung noted. “The only real opportunity for several species to recuperate would be to stop overfishing and safeguard them to ensure that the populations can rebuild,” he added.

“If action isn’t taken immediately, our generation might find a lot more species stick to the actions from the Chinese bahaba,” Cheung stated.

Steve Murawski, a College of South Florida professor and formerly chief science consultant for that U.S. National Marine Fisheries Service, stated “it’s tough to evaluate the veracity from the results or even the scientific support” for that findings since the full report has not been released.

But he noted that within the U . s . States “a powerful group of management needs backed through the pressure of law have led to an finish to domestic overfishing.”

“This really is obviously an extremely hopeful sign since the USA is really an essential fishing nation,” he added. “May be the record commensurate globally? No it’s not, and therefore I’d certainly support” the panel’s advice to lessen global fishing “to levels corresponding to lengthy-term sustainability of fisheries and also the marine atmosphere.”

Solar forecast hints at big chill

The sun’s rays sets loose a effective photo voltaic flare in the right side of their disk on June 7, as observed in this picture from NASA’s Photo voltaic Dynamics Observatory. Researchers the sun is heading toward an optimum in the activity cycle in 2013 approximately, but may enter a time of hibernation after.

The most recent lengthy-range space forecast forecasts an unpredicted drop in photo voltaic activity following the next peak – and researchers state that might awesome lower temps here on the planet, or at best decelerate the warming trend a little.

Researchers have analyzed sunspots and also the sun’s 11-year activity cycle for 400 years, and they are getting progressively savvy about recognizing the harbingers of “space weather” years ahead of time, just like meteorologists can determine what’s coming following the next storm.

Storms in the sun are required to construct to some peak in 2013 approximately, but next, the lengthy-range indications are going for an extended duration of low activity – as well as hibernation.

“This will be significant since the photo voltaic cycle causes space weather … and could lead to global warming,” Frank Hill, connect director from the National Photo voltaic Observatory’s Photo voltaic Synoptic Network, told journalists today.

Previously, such periods have coincided with lower-than-expected temps on the planet. Probably the most famous example may be the Maunder Minimum, a 70-year period with without any sunspots from 1645 to 1715. Average temps in Europe sank so low throughout that period it found be referred to as “the small Ice Age.”

The linkage between photo voltaic activity and global warming continues to be dependent on scientific debate. And even when there’s a hyperlink, it isn’t obvious how photo voltaic-triggered global cooling might connect to industrial climatic change because of green house-gas pollutants. Climate researchers the shifts in photo voltaic activity that they have analyzed to date have experienced little if any effect on temps or any other climate indications – plus they don’t be prepared to visit a large impact even when the sun’s rays goes quiet for any decade or longer.

But when present day forecast is correct, photo voltaic physicists and climatologists may have a chance to discover without a doubt.

Hill stated researchers had “not a way of predicting” how lengthy the hibernation period might last. “It might easily last as lengthy because the Maunder Minimum … whether it happens,” he stated.

Hill along with other experts on photo voltaic activity introduced the lengthy-range forecast today in the annual meeting from the American Astronomical Society’s Photo voltaic Physics Division, being carried out now at New Mexico Condition College in Las Cruces, N.M.

How can they are fully aware?

The forecast is dependant on three indications regarded as associated with lengthy-range photo voltaic activity, the comparative go up and down of sunspots within the activity cycle, along with the brightness of individuals sunspots designs within the sun’s internal “jet stream” of superheated plasma and also the pace of migration within the sun’s magnetic area toward the rods, as observed in the sun’s corona.

An abnormally low quantity of sunspots happen to be observed throughout the present cycle, and also the spots are fainter than average. Researchers say they’ve seen no manifestation of a characteristic east-west flow of internal plasma, which often sets happens for future increases in activity. And also the magnetic “hurry towards the rods” allears to become slowing down lower.

Each one of these signs claim that the present photo voltaic cycle, Cycle 24, “might be the final one for quite a while,” Hill stated. The following upswing in photo voltaic storms, Cycle 25, might be “greatly postponed … very weak, or might not happen whatsoever.”

At night climate effect, photo voltaic activity may possess a significant potential effect on satellite procedures, electric energy grids as well as contact with radiation at high-altitudes. Photo voltaic storms can disrupt satellite signals or air-traffic satnav systems. In 1989, a photo voltaic episode triggered a common energy outage in Quebec. And particularly strong photo voltaic flares have forced astronauts to consider shelter in shielded regions of the area shuttle or even the Worldwide Space Station.

Some experts have concerned about the potential of an enormous geomagnetic super-storm like the one which taken over Earth in 1859, referred to as “Carrington event.” For individuals folks, this news the sun seems to become settling lower, combined with signs the 2013 photo voltaic maximum isn’t likely to be abnormally strong, ought to be reassuring.

About this ice age …

Hill and 2 other photo voltaic physicists involved with creating the forecast, NSO investigator Matt Penn and Richard Altrock from the U.S. Air Force’s coronal research program, stated there is not enough data to set an environment link with photo voltaic activity. However they along with other researchers have noted that historic lulls in sunspots, like the Maunder Minimum and the other photo voltaic minimum between 1790 and 1830, coincided with cooler temps.

Gavin Schmidt, a climatologist at NASA’s Goddard Institute for Space Studies and among the founders from the RealClimate blog, stated the results of photo voltaic activity on climate in the last 3 decades happen to be “in the margin of what we should can identify.”

“They’re noticeable within the high atmosphere, however when you get lower towards the surface, there’s a lot other things happening it’s been really challenging a clean signal,” he explained.

A primary reason why so very little is famous about photo voltaic effects on climate would be that the selection of the sun’s levels and lows happen to be relatively narrow in the recent past.

“As we were to determine coming back to what’s known as Maunder Minimum conditions within the next half a century approximately, that might be interesting,” Schmidt stated. “I believe we’d become familiar with a lot about photo voltaic physics and photo voltaic variability. … It will likely be scientifically thrilling if all of this pans out.”

Even so, however, he believed the effect of green house-gas pollutants could be about the order of 10 occasions as great. “What you are able see on the 20- to 30-year period is really a slight downturn within the pace of warming,” Schmidt stated. “When it comes to the way you should consider global warming conjecture later on, reducing pollutants and so forth, it wouldn’t make a difference.”

But how about the small Ice Age within the 1600s, when Swiss All downhill towns were reported destroyed by encroaching glaciers? Schmidt stated that period also coincided by having an upswing in volcanic pollutants, that are known more certainly to lead to global cooling.

“Parsing out just how much of this was photo voltaic, just how much of this was volcanic and just how a lot of which was just noise … that’s tricky,” Schmidt stated.

Dead Sea both shrinking and flooding


The Dead Ocean is dying, goes the the usual understanding: Water degree of the fabled salty lake is shedding over 3 ft annually. Less well-known: Area of the lake is really overflowing, threatening among Israel’s key tourism locations.

Israel is feverishly campaigning to achieve the Dead Ocean – the cheapest point on the planet and repository of precious minerals – named among the natural miracles around the globe. Simultaneously, it’s racing to stabilize what it really calls “the earth’s biggest natural health spa” so hotels on its southern finish aren’t swamped and vacationers could soak within the lake’s therapeutic waters.

Without intervention, “in five to ten years, (water) would ton your accommodation lobbies, no question,” stated Alon Tal, among the scientists the federal government has commissioned to locate a solution.

The Dead Ocean is split right into a southern and northern basin, that are situated at different elevations, largely disconnected and miles apart. Which means increasing waters from the southern basin cannot simply pour in to the diminishing basin within the north.

Heavy industrialization is what’s leading to the waters about the southern basin to increase. Chemical companies have built evaporation pools there to extract lucrative minerals in the lake. An incredible number of a lot of salt remain yearly on the ground of those pools, leading to water to increase 8 inches annually.

Israel’s tourism and environment protection ministers are promoting Tal’s most costly proposal: An intricate $2 billion intend to nick from the salt buildup for the river that’s rising and send it by conveyor belt towards the northern finish that’s shedding.

They are also demanding that Dead Ocean Works Ltd. – the multibillion-dollar Israeli industry that mines the mineral-wealthy waters – feet the balance.

“Because the polluters, they ought to pay,” stated Roee Elisha, connect director from the Dead Ocean Upkeep Government Company Ltd., a branch of Israel’s Tourism Ministry.

The Dead Ocean, that is from the sites from the scriptural Sodom and Gomorra, runs a lot more than 60 miles through Israel, free airline Bank and Jordan. Its minerals happen to be desired since ancient occasions: The pharaohs were embalmed using the lake’s natural asphalt protuberances, and Nefertiti is stated to possess used its skin-reviving salts and dirt.

Today, the river is just one of Israel’s top tourism draws. 1 / 2 of the three.45 million vacationers to Israel compensated an end there this year. Almost 200,000 remained within the 4,000 rooms in hotels across the lake. Local people flock there too, using more than 630,000 – or almost one out of 10 Israelis – investing time at Dead Ocean hotels this past year.

Dead Ocean tourism revenue totaled some $300 million this past year, propping up a business that makes up about 1000’s of jobs in part of the nation that otherwise offers limited employment possibilities.

Current efforts to preserve the Dead Ocean like a natural treasure shine a spotlight how extensively the river continues to be used by modern industry – and just how it paradoxically also is dependent on industry because of its survival.

Israel’s Dead Ocean Works and Jordan’s Arab Potash mine Dead Ocean waters for potash along with other minerals, conveying them worldwide to be used in manure, cosmetics, cars and laptops.

The southern basin now at risk of flooding nearly dried out prior to the chemical companies intervened. Within the sixties, Dead Ocean Works dug a ten-mile canal to function saltwater in the lake’s northern basin into its nearly parched southern finish, making it a network of evaporation pools.

That pool is how the majority of the Israeli hotels lie, and where vacationers bob in filmy water so heavy with salt and minerals they float.

But because the water increases, it encroaches on hotel beaches, where blobs of salt stand out close to the shores and also the salty floor sparkles within the turquoise waters. At one beach, stairs resulting in the river have grown to be half-immersed, along with a sun umbrella permanently attached towards the edge has become deep within the water.

Dead Ocean Works states it’ll feet a few of the bill to dredge the salt in the evaporation pools and send it north, but is settling its tell the federal government, stated Noam Goldstein, the business’s v . p . of infrastructure.

Environmentalists accuse the organization of capitalizing in the cost of the ecology. Its factory of smokestacks, pipes and levers looms in the tip from the lake, and it is trucks sit high atop snow-whitened piles of potash.

The organization counters that without them, vacationers in Israeli hotels might have absolutely nothing to go swimming in – hotels take a seat on banks of the evaporation pools.

The salt dredging proposal still awaits your final government approval.

It is the exact opposite problem in the Dead Sea’s northern basin, in which the level is shedding along with a barren, pockmarked moonscape has changed sandy beaches.

Old boardwalks that when brought in to the lake now stand in the center of empty land. At one beach, bathers must ride a trolley towards the lake’s edge.

Israel, Jordan and Syria have the effect of the northern Dead Sea’s dramatic shrinkage: They’ve rerouted the Jordan River and it is tributaries for h2o, drastically lowering the amount that accustomed to flow in to the Dead Ocean. The Israeli and Jordanian industries also generate water in the ocean for his or her evaporation pools.

The Planet Bank is studying a decades-old proposal to replenish the northern Dead Sea’s waters by directing water via a canal in the Red-colored Ocean, a lot more than 100 miles south. With costs believed at as much as $15 billion and also the environment unwanted effects unpredictable, the Red-colored-Dead canal rarely is in built in the near future.

Meanwhile, Israel’s cabinet lately introduced it might invest $2.5 million to promote the Dead Ocean within the worldwide New 7 Miracles of Character competition, which finishes in November.

Gura Berger, project manager for that Tourism Ministry’s Dead Ocean pr campaign, states winning the competition may help revive the river and become a significant boost to area tourism.

“We would like the Dead Ocean that need considering a question around the globe, so you will see a pursuit to safeguard it,” Berger stated.

Tires and the environment


There is a common perception the tires we placed on our automobiles are constructed with

rubber, a renewable resource. Regrettably, more than 90% of tires are created

from synthetics – and they’ve certainly demonstrated to become an environment

headache.

Once tires have arrived at the finish of the serviceable lives, they are usually

left in huge piles. If these piles ought to be set alight, the smoke is definitely an

extremely toxic cocktail and also the runoff from melted residue can

contaminate groundwater.

Tires left hanging out on view also collect rainwater and be

perfect breeding grounds for mosquitos.

In the united states, about 300 million tires are scrapped or left each year. While

there is lots of discuss recycling tires, 25% still end up in landfills

and nearly 1 / 2 of reclaimed tires in the united states are used as “Tire Derived

Fuel” (TDF), usually burned alongside other fuels for example coal.

Burning tires creating immeasureable polluting of the environment, that contains harmful toxins such

as:

– benzene (carcinogen)

– lead

– polycyclic aromatic hydrocarbons

– butadiene (nervous system damage, carcinogen)

– styrene (potential carcinogen)

– dioxins

– furans

So regrettably, taking tires to recycling centres mightn’t be that earth

friendly in the end. Seek advice from the center that put forth regarding what goes on

towards the tires they collect.

While tires really are a unfortunate requirement within our modern lives, there’s the main things we

can perform to lessen the amount of tires that could find yourself getting used like a toxic fuel

alternative or simply left in landfills. You may also avoid wasting money in the

process.

You are able to extend tire existence substantially by:

– checking to ascertain if they’re inflated to proper levels

– check inflation levels weekly

– don’t speed

– corner, brake and begin off lightly

– ensure your tires are correctly balanced and rotated regularly

– don’t overload your automobile.

Just an essential point on tire inflation – temperature variations will

affect pressure levels simply throughout the span of merely one day. Should you check

your tires each morning, odds are pressure level is going to be noticeably

less than within the mid-day. This does not mean that you ought to adjust inflation

many occasions each day but it is why they must be checked regularly – because the

seasons change, same goes with your tire pressure. This can also be whenever you

travel from a place of low elevation to high elevation. Apart from

environment and financial reasons, making certain your tires are correctly inflated

is a vital facet of safe driving.

Environmentalists, tuna fishers battle at sea


Tuna anglers fought environmentalists about the Mediterranean, hurling heavy links of chain at them because the environmentalists tried to disrupt illegal tuna fishing underneath the no-fly zone north of Libya on Saturday.

The anglers also tried to lay a rope while watching activists’ boat, the Steve Irwin – possessed through the U.S.-based Ocean Shepherd Conservation Society – wishing to disable it. Environmentalists responded with fire hoses and stink tanks.

Hundreds of ft across the fray circled a French fighter jet, summoned through the anglers – who stated, wrongly, that activist divers were attempting to cut their internet.

The 60-meter (195-feet) Steve Irwin, named following the Australian conservationist who died in 2006, left the Sicilian port of Syracuse early Friday, at risk of a rendezvous having a more compact, faster sister ship, the Brigitte Bardot, just north of Libyan waters. The Bardot had traversed the region and reported that 20 purse seiners were operating there.

Purse seiners are motorboats that deploy large nets that draw closed just like a purse, ensnaring the tuna. The seafood are then sometimes place in floating internet-cages and gradually towed to port.

Ocean Shepherd is on the pursuit to disrupt motorboats which are fishing unlawfully. The stock of bluefin tuna, which spawn within the Mediterranean after which go swimming to its northern border Atlantic, continues to be depleted to the stage that some experts fear it’ll soon collapse.

Late within the day, getting damaged from the earlier confrontation, the Irwin and also the Bardot joined Libyan waters looking for illegal fishing boats for sale there.

Saturday’s confrontation started to consider shape in the beginning light because the sun lifted and blazed a blinding stripe over the ocean. Ten purse seiners were working several miles in the Steve Irwin one way, and five were spotted down another path

The ship’s crew are true followers only vegan fare is offered aboard. But Captain Paul Watson, the Ocean Shepherd founder, along with other officials say they merely pursue motorboats which are fishing unlawfully – when they are not allocated a quota by ICCAT, the Worldwide Commission for that Conservation of Atlantic Tunas, or have exceeded it, or their catch includes a lot of juveniles.

Because the Steve Irwin contacted the number of five motorboats Saturday to find out their details and inspect their catch, high stakes controlling started at close quarters.

The motorboats were Tunisian, and a minimum of one, based on the Steve Irwin’s crew, wasn’t licensed to seafood and they didn’t react to radio calls.

The Ocean Shepherd environmentalists, who’ve no official enforcement forces, used a little launch to examine the cage, as the Tunisians all of a sudden scrambled two, then three small dinghies to safeguard their internet. Others attempted to chop from the Steve Irwin or chase it away.

Anglers within the bigger motorboats put heavy links of chain in the environmentalists – striking nobody, but eventually forcing the launch to retreat without having the ability to determine whether there have been tuna within the cage.

A bigger Tunisian boat drawn alongside the Steve Irwin and also the crew pelted the environmentalists with chain links. The crew from the Irwin responded with stink tanks that contains, they stated, rancid butter.

A Tunisian dinghy also towed a rope while watching Steve Irwin, wishing it might get twisted within the propeller and disable the ship.

Meanwhile, the Tunisians might be overheard radioing in france they military for help, saying environmentalist divers were within the water attempting to cut their nets.

Which was not the situation. However, the Ocean Shepherd volunteers are ready to do this to free the tuna, when they determine the fishing to possess been illegal – and they’ve cut nets previously.

The Irwin’s officials considered delivering in divers at this time too harmful. The Tunisians were aggressive, plus they had used divers to safeguard their cage, that could have brought, essentially, to hands-to-hands combat within the ocean.

A French military jet made an appearance in this area quickly and travelled within the area at an altitude of a few hundred ft because the drama unfolded below. The pilot later scolded the crew from the Steve Irwin for endangering human lives.

Eventually, the Steve Irwin broke off contact. Officials about the ship stated a minumum of one from the motorboats had no quota designated. Watson along with other officials about the Irwin stated they found the Tunisian’s behavior suspicious. But a guy declaring to become an ICCAT inspector radioed from aboard, and also the Ocean Shepherd activists couldn’t determine for several the activities were illegal.

On Saturday evening, both ships joined Libyan waters. The Brigitte Bardot went ahead and radioed it had found some possible targets.

China lead pollution outbreak poisons 103 children

The pollution from tinfoil-making training courses in Yangxunqiao town in Zhejiang province left the kids, aged 14 or more youthful, with 250 microgrammes or even more of lead for each liter of bloodstream.

Another 26 grown ups put together to possess “severe lead poisoning, or using more than 600 microgrammes of lead per liter of bloodstream,” the report stated, stating local health authorities.

“Employees as well as their family people, including children, are constantly uncovered to guide materials in the household-run training courses,” stated the report, adding that the dozen from the children were receiving medical therapy for that lead.

Nearly 500 other citizens from the township put together to possess “moderate” lead poisoning, with 400 to 600 microgrammes of lead per liter of bloodstream.

This is actually the latest reported situation of the pollution problem which has stricken many cities and towns across China, where citizens frequently live within meters of laxly controlled industrial facilities and training courses competing to create inexpensively.

That industrial growth has run facing citizens progressively concerned about their own health. The majority of the employees within the tinfoil vegetation is migrants using their company, lesser areas of China, stated the Xinhua report.

lead poisoning can develop through regular contact with small quantities of lead, harmful the nervous and reproductive systems and renal system, in addition to leading to high bloodstream pressure and anemia. Lead is particularly dangerous for kids and can result in learning difficulties and behavior problems.

China’s atmosphere ministry has known as for urgent measures to tackle heavy metal and rock poisoning as cases of mass poisoning have produced common public anger.

“Preventing heavy metal and rock pollution concerns the healthiness of the folks, especially children’s health, and concerns social harmony and stability,” the Minister of Environment Protection, Zhou Shengxian, stated in May.

But Beijing has frequently unsuccessful to complement vows to wash up polluters using the assets and political will to enforce such demands, as local authorities put growth, revenue and jobs in front of environment protection.

China may be the world’s greatest consumer of refined lead, and

battery making makes up about 70 % of this consumption, which will probably grow to 4.a million tonnes this year.

A large number of people living near a large battery factory in Zhejiang put together to possess precariously high amounts of lead poisoning, local news reviews stated in March.

Last Year, protesters broke into one smelting plant they blamed for that lead poisoning in excess of 600 children, and smashed trucks and tore lower fences before police stopped them.

Confronted with rising public concern, the federal government has stated it’ll crack lower on lead pollution, particularly in Zhejiang province, which hosts many small producers of batteries along with other items which use the metal.

Around three-quarters of lead-acidity battery manufacturing plants in China might be eliminated within the next two to three years after Beijing released a attack, a business body stated recently.

In Yangxunqiao, the website from the latest pollution outbreak, 25 training courses suspended production, stated Xinhua. The township has nearly 200 tinfoil-making training courses that as a whole employ a lot more than 2,500 people, stated the report.

Mysterious mountain lion killed in Connecticut

The 140-pound mountain lion was hit with a small Vehicle on the highway in Milton, Connecticut early ‘life was imple’, and died from the injuries. The motive force was unhurt, authorities stated.

Without any native mountain lion population within the condition, “it is possible as well as likely” it’s the same enormous cat having a lengthy tail spotted last weekend within the New You are able to City suburb some 30 miles away, stated Department of Environment Protection spokesperson Dennis Schain.

The big cat was moved to some condition environment facility where government bodies uses the photos, paw prints along with other evidence collected close to the three Greenwich sightings to find out if it’s exactly the same animal.

Traveling between your two metropolitan areas will be a jog with this large cat recognized to roam extensively, even up to and including approximately 200 miles per day, stated Schain.

The eastern mountain lion was formally declared extinct captured, compelling government bodies to suspect your pet spotted within the urban jungle from the New You are able to City metropolitan area, had either steered clear of or was launched from captivity.

The nearest confirmed population of mountain lions is within Missouri, midway across the nation.

Mountain lions, also called a cougar or puma, are lone creatures that within the east mainly preyed on whitened-tailed deer.

“Generally, cougars wish to stay as far from people as they can since they’re so solitary,” stated Bob Wilson, a co-founding father of The Cougar Network, a business dedicated to monitoring and researching your pet.

Wilson stated mountain lions prefer to search within the shadows and it might be an extremely remote opportunity to encounter the kitty.

The eastern cougar was hunted and trapped “non-stop” and gone from a lot of the location through the late 1800s, based on the U.S. Seafood and Wildlife Service. Around the same time frame its habitat was destroyed by deforestation and also the population of their prey rejected.

How our planet’s infernos affect climate

Instantly, images from the forest fire raging in Arizona and also the volcano erupting in Chile appear to suggest they’re filling the climate with gases and debris which will wreck havoc on the worldwide climate, but experts say this week’s occasions, in isolation, aren’t much to bother with.

The Willow fire in Arizona has charred a minimum of 336,000 acres to date, filling the climate with smoke, smoke, and also the green house gas co2. It joins a string of fires which have raged elsewhere within the U.S., including Texas and Florida.

The quantity of green house gases from these kinds of fires “can be very substantial,” Matt Hurteau, a forest ecologist at Northern Arizona College explained today.

As one example of how substantial, he pointed to operate brought by Christine Wiedinmyer in the National Center for Atmospheric Research in Boulder, Colorado, that shows forest fires within the U.S. between 2001 and 2008 paid for for 6 to 8 percent of total annual U.S. green house gas pollutants.

One fire alone, however, is really a blip in comparison towards the pollutants from burning non-renewable fuels for example oil and coal to energy the worldwide economy.

“A typical misunderstanding is the fact that fire pollutants are huge in comparison to fossil fuel pollutants,” Beverly Law, a forest ecologist at Or Condition College explained today. “They aren’t, really. Fossil fuel pollutants trump everything.”

Fire forecasts

However the fires burning in Arizona and elsewhere across the southern tier of U.S. do fit forecasts from types of global global warming that suggest the buildup of green house gases within the atmosphere may cause the southwest, within the long-term, being drier, Law added.

“We simply can’t say there’s an immediate expected outcomes immediately,Inch she stated.

Actually, historic forest management choices in Arizona play a significant role in the seriousness of fires there, Hurteau stated. Within the ancient past, the ponderosa pine forests burned frequently and, consequently, were open coupled with a grassy understory. The grass, consequently, offered as fuel for forest fires.

From the 1800s, pioneer settlers moved west and grazed the forests using their animals, which reduced the fuels. Then, within the 1900s, an insurance policy of fire suppression brought to elevated forest density. “Now we have got these really dense forests which are vulnerable to this kind of wildfire event,” he stated.

The result of the management on forest fire ecology is in addition to the climate signal. In addition, it’s the weather on a day that drives the seriousness of fire.

“To express that global warming is leading to that weather tomorrow, we can not do this because weather conditions are the long run trend,” Hurteau stated.

Nonetheless, long-term climate trends suggest the southwest will end up drier, thus more vulnerable to wildfire. More wildfire, will also put more green house gases in to the atmosphere, that ought to result in more alterations in the worldwide climate, he noted.

Volcanoes and cooling

Volcanoes, however, could possibly awesome the climate by spewing the gas sulfur dioxide in to the stratosphere where it blocks sunlight from reaching Earth, thus leading to cooling. The eruption from the Puyehue-Cordón Caulle volcano in Chile, however, doesn’t have the symptoms of done that.

“It wasn’t an enormous injection of SO2,” Alan Robock, an environment researcher who studies the bond between volcanoes and climate, explained today. “Although it shut lower air traffic over Argentina and Chile due to the ash, we will not have the ability to begin to see the climate effect.”

The final time a volcanic eruption cooled the climate was the 1991 eruption of Mt. Pinatubo within the Philippines, which triggered global temps to awesome by about 50 % a diploma Celsius for a few years.

The dramatic images from the Puyehue-Cordón Caulle show a huge ash cloud. The contaminants will drop out rapidly, creating havoc in your area, however they do not have a lengthy-term climate effect.

A cooling effect will ultimately originates from an explosive eruption that puts sulfur in to the stratosphere, Charles Stern, a geologist in the College of Colorado at Boulder explained today.

“And that is good, we’re able to make use of a little cooling at this time,Inch he stated.

Actually, researchers have started to go over the thought of deliberately filling the stratosphere with sulfur to imitate the cooling effect of the Pinatubo-style eruption. Stern and Robock, though, stated this geoengineering approach is not advisable because of the expense along with other unwanted effects.
